PER CURIAM.
Deidre Jackson appeals the district court’s1 adverse judgment following a
bench trial in her employment discrimination action. After careful review of the
1The Honorable Katherine M. Menendez, United States District Judge for the
District of Minnesota.

-- 1 of 2 --

record and the parties’ arguments on appeal, we find no basis for reversal. See
Wright v. St. Vincent Health Sys., 730 F.3d 732, 737 (8th Cir. 2013) (after bench
trial, this court reviews district court’s factual findings for clear error and its legal
conclusions de novo). Accordingly, we affirm. See 8th Cir. R. 47B.
